7 Layer Pizza Dip
Ingredients
- 2 cups tomato sauce
- 1 cups cooked ground turkey sausage
- 2 cups shredded Parmesan cheese
- 1/2 cup Italian seasoning
- 1 cup chopped cooked broccoli
- 1 cup mini pepperoni
- 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ese
- additional mini pepperoni for sprinkling on surface
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 375°F. Take a regular-sized deep dish baking casserole pan (please note the one in the photo was for half the serving this recipe makes). Starting with tomato sauce, spread it evenly across the bottom layer. Then layer on the second ingredient, and repeating with remaining until you have completed your layered dip.
- Bake for about 15-20 minutes or until cheese turns bubbling. Serve with tortilla chips, pita bread, or anything else you desire.
Notes
- You can customize the fillings for this dip, but I don't recommend using ingredients that will release a lot of moisture while they cook like mushrooms and peppers.
